PSYX 203 - Introduction to Social Science Research Methods

4 Credit(s)
A survey of research methods and tools used by behavioral scientists. Students are expected to demonstrate understanding and comprehension of course content through course examinations, out-of-class writing assignments, and the critical application of course content to a student-selected problem. Lecture, small group discussions, and problem-solving.

Behav/Soci Sci.
